G.A. Spagnuolo is a leading researcher in nuclear fusion engineering, specializing in the thermal-hydraulic and safety analysis of fusion reactor components. His work is pivotal to the design of the European DEMO (EU DEMO) fusion reactor, particularly in understanding and mitigating heat transfer challenges during reactor shutdown. His most-cited paper, "CFD analysis of natural convection cooling of the in-vessel components during a shutdown of the EU DEMO fusion reactor" (2021), provides critical insights into passive cooling strategies, ensuring the structural integrity of in-vessel components when active cooling systems are offline.
